Audi a4 1.8tq brake lights not working
So I've searched many forums and have found about 10 threads about the same problem but none have solutions. Problem: my taillights went out the other day but the third brake light still works??? I'm gonna grab some fuses and bulbs this afternoon. I checked the fuse and it's fine...but might as well grab a pack and switch it just in case. Could it be the brake light switch??? Are there any relays that are tied only to the rear brake lights and not the third or is it possible to burn out half of a relay or brake switch??? The car is going to get replaced this spring...probably a newer a4. This one has many electrical gremlins and about 200k and it's a 1997. Mechanically it's perfect...never had a motor issue other than replacing the coil packs. Oh and the turn signals/reverse lights/ect. all work like they should. I'm stumped...please help. Thanks

That sounds like it has to be a switch issue, unless you've severed a wire and/or ground somewhere.
Check the wiring at the brake lights with a DMM or a test light. If you're not getting juice to the brake lights, then you know it's prior to that.
I'm guessing it's the switch though.
